Do I need a special license to drive a Penske truck?
No, you do not need a special license to drive a Penske truck. As long as you have a valid driver's license, you can rent and drive a Penske truck. However, there are some restrictions based on the size of the truck. For trucks with a gross vehicle weight rating (GVWR) of 26,000 pounds or less, a standard driver's license is sufficient. If the truck has a GVWR exceeding 26,000 pounds, a commercial driver's license (CDL) is required. It is important to check with your local Penske Truck Rental location and verify the specific requirements and regulations regarding licensing before renting a truck.
